It is with great sadness and heavy heart that we announce the untimely passing of Dwight Potter of Etobicoke on June 27 at age 63.
Dwight was loved and is survived by his wife Brenda, his son Harrison, daughters Sarah and Hillary, mother in law Anna, and brothers in law Denny and Robert Niksic.
He is predeceased by his parents Teresa and Lou Potter. He will be dearly missed by the beloved family chihuahuas, Lucy and Lil Pup.
Dwight was renowned in the investment industry and had a long tenure with BMO Nesbitt Burns where he was Senior Vice President and Managing Director and ran one of the largest franchises in the GTA. While Dwight had many great achievements in his career, he also found enjoyment in his fine car collection and in attending sporting events. He will be missed by Horst, Chris and Victor of whom he spoke very highly, and also by the rest of his team and numerous colleagues.
